What is the Unemployment Deferment Request Form?
The Unemployment Deferment Request Form serves as a crucial mechanism for borrowers of the William D. Ford Federal Direct Loan Program to pause their loan repayments due to unemployment. This form aims to provide a structured process for those in need of financial relief during difficult employment circumstances. By filling out the unemployment deferment request form, borrowers can make a significant step toward managing their student loan deferment.

Eligibility Criteria for the Unemployment Deferment Request Form
Eligibility for the unemployment deferment request form is defined by specific criteria related to unemployment status. To qualify, borrowers must provide supporting evidence that confirms their current unemployment situation. Acceptable types of documentation include:
-
Official letters from employers detailing unemployment status.
-
Unemployment benefits statements.
-
Any additional documentation that proves ongoing unemployment.

Timing and Renewal of the Unemployment Deferment Request Form
Understanding the timing and renewal process for the unemployment deferment request form is essential for maintaining deferment status. Borrowers should be aware of the following important timeframes:
-
Re-application is required every six months.
-
Deadlines for submission to avoid loan repayment resuming.

What are the eligibility requirements for the Unemployment Deferment Request Form?
To be eligible for the Unemployment Deferment, borrowers must be enrolled in the Federal Direct Loan Program and demonstrate that they are currently unemployed or seeking full-time employment.
Is there a deadline for submitting the Unemployment Deferment Request Form?
There is no formal deadline; however, it's advised to submit your request as soon as you become unemployed to prevent missed payment penalties.
How should I submit the completed deferment form?
After completing your form on pdfFiller, you can print it to mail or download it for electronic submission via your loan servicer’s platform, if available.
What supporting documents are needed for the Unemployment Deferment Request?
Typically, you will need to provide documentation of your unemployment status, such as unemployment benefits verification, along with your completed form.
What common mistakes should I avoid when filling out the Unemployment Deferment Request Form?
Be sure not to leave any required fields blank and double-check all information for accuracy, particularly your loan number and personal details.
How long does it take to process the Unemployment Deferment Request?
Processing times for deferment requests can vary; generally, you should allow 4-6 weeks for your request to be reviewed and a decision communicated.
Do I need to notarize the Unemployment Deferment Request Form?
No, notarization is not required for this form. Ensure you sign it where indicated to certify the information provided is accurate.
